Quote:
Originally Posted by eneuman
good to know. i might have to start using that. do you instal it on a server, and then have the diskless nodes do a lan boot from it?
Yep, I used an old P2 system as the LTSP server and all the nodes boot off of it via network
There is almost no configuration required with it, start LTSP server and then configure the nodes to boot from network via PXE (or floppy). It folds as soon as they boot and it is very easy to upgrade the folding client/troubleshoot it.
